If you're planning to register as a maid, cook, driver, babysitter, or eldercare attendant in India, one of the first questions is always: "Which documents do I actually need?" The good news is that the process is much simpler than most people expect — you don't need a pile of paperwork, just a few essential documents that help agencies verify who you are and build trust with employers.

Employers today are far more cautious about who they let into their homes — and rightly so. A documented, verified registration protects both sides: it gives families confidence that you are who you say you are, and it protects you as a worker by creating a formal record of your registration, experience, and identity. Genuine agencies use this information purely for verification — never to charge you a fee.
Your Aadhaar card is the single most important document in the registration process. It's used to confirm your identity and address, and it's what allows an agency to run a basic verification before recommending you to a family. Without a valid Aadhaar card, most agencies — including Labourwala — cannot proceed with registration.
A clear, recent photo is used for your registration profile, which employers see before an interview. It doesn't need to be a professional studio photo — a clear, well-lit photo taken on a phone works fine, as long as your face is clearly visible.
Any valid address proof — this could be your Aadhaar card itself (if it has your current address), a rent agreement, electricity bill, or voter ID. This helps confirm where you currently live, which is especially useful for local job matching in areas like Dehradun, Haridwar, Rishikesh, or Mussoorie.
If you've worked as domestic staff before, any proof — a reference letter, a previous employer's contact number, or even a WhatsApp message confirming your work history — strengthens your profile significantly. It's not mandatory, but it can help you get matched faster, especially for higher-paying roles.
While not always required at the registration stage, having your bank account details ready (account number and IFSC code) speeds up the process once you're placed with an employer, since most families today prefer paying salaries directly to a bank account rather than in cash.
Decide which role fits you best — maid, cook, driver, babysitter, gardener, or eldercare/patient care attendant. This helps the agency match you with the right kind of employer from the start.
Provide your basic details: name, WhatsApp number, experience level, preferred working hours (8/10/24 hours), and availability (immediate, within 15 days, or within a month).
Share your Aadhaar card, photo, and address proof with the agency — either by uploading them on the website or sending them over WhatsApp.
The agency's team calls to confirm your details and answer any questions you have about the process, pay, or working conditions.
Once verified, your profile is shared with employers looking for someone with your skills and availability. You choose whether to proceed with an interview — there's no obligation.
Genuine agencies never charge job seekers a registration or verification fee. If anyone asks you to pay before finding you a job, that's a red flag. For more on this, see our detailed guide: How to Get a Maid/Cook Job in Dehradun Without Any Fees.
